Most residential tanks hold 40 to 60 gallons and need to withstand the pressure of a residential water system (typically 50 to 100 psi.) steel tanks are tested to handle 300 psi and have a bonded glass liner to keep rust out of the water, as well as insulation surrounding the tank. The t&p valve is a tiny device sitting atop or just a bit below the top of a water heater. As residential valves can be prone to failure, it’s important that you check your valve at least once a year by pulling up on the handle.
